Point of Interest: Stolen laptop

On orientation day, Aug. 27, math teacher Chris Millsback left his computer on his desk before going to the high-school orientation meeting.

Since desks and other furniture were still being moved in, the room was unlocked at the time.

When he returned, Millsback realized his school-issued Macbook Pro was missing.

Nothing else was stolen, but the value of the brand new computer was approximately $1200.

The school did not contact police and, according to Tom Wroten, director of technology, the tracking software installed on the computer has been unable to locate it.

In light of the incident, teachers have been advised to store their laptops in their lockable file cabinets.
